(Jane wanted information from Seth about her struggle last night with what she believed to be a thought form she had created while sleeping. The experience had been somewhat frightening, and she was quite certain it was not a nightmare.
(Instead however Seth began to talk about Jane’s evident conflict with an editor at Ace Books. Last Thursday, March 20, Jane had written Ace demanding the return of her dream book manuscript because of the delay in hearing from Ace—but once—since last December.)
